Transaction 7e996859153852eda71f48dd0c266a23cceaaaf6859a2099db461c8bc20dcc39
1 Input
1 Output
-
7e996859153852eda71f48dd0c266a23cceaaaf6859a2099db461c8bc20dcc39:0
- value
- 4928120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b867e75a25351991b61b06cc6d77670b55e3d78 OP_EQUAL
- address
- 3JnZQDpHNhXagQLLzN4sUCokSTfmk9chQB